Cleaning performance

Robots aren't as efficient as vacuums at cleaning deep into carpets and cleaning up dirt that's been hidden. However, they are able to collect small particles like dust and baking soda as well as larger debris like metal screws and pet fur. They also can sweep up spills and crumbs. Maintaining a routine of maintenance, such as emptying the dust bin cleaning or replacing the filter, and cleaning sensors and cameras, will help you get the longest possible lifespan from your robot.

The best robots are great in removing fine particles from hard carpets and floors with low pile. They're also good at picking up orzo, sand and wood shavings. They can pick up metal screws and cat litter, but they struggle with slower items like coffee grounds or baked flour. They're not as impressive when climbing stairs, and do not always grab everything that is around the edges.

Maintenance

A robot cleaner is a great way to keep your house in order, especially when it is used by children or pets. However, it requires some attention to ensure it is in top condition. Maintaining a regular schedule of cleaning tasks, like emptying the dust bin and washing or replacing the filter, and wiping down cameras and sensors can prolong the life of your robot.

Vacuums require more frequent maintenance than robot mopping machines however, you can extend the life of your vacuum by making sure you follow the manufacturer's instructions to empty and clean its dustbin, brush roller, and filter. Clean the robot's charging contacts and sensor using a damp rag to avoid them becoming blocked.
